Donna L. Black

August 29, 1939 — January 31, 2021

Donna L. (Singer) Black New Freedom - Donna L. (Singer) Black, 81, of New Freedom, died Sunday, January 31, 2021 at her home. She was the wife of the late William U. Black, Sr. who shared a wonderful marriage of 63 years together. A public viewing will be held from 11:00 am to 12:00 noon on Friday February 5, 2021 at Geiple-Predicce Funeral & Cremation Services, Inc., 53 Main Street, Glen Rock. A private family only funeral service will follow at the funeral home. Interment will be in Bethlehem Steltz Church Cemetery, Glen Rock. Due to the COVID-19 guidelines, masks and social distancing are required and attendance in the funeral home is limited to 25 people at a time. Donna was born in New Freedom and was a daughter of the late Rhoda H. (Krout) and Ralph Singer, Sr. She retired in 2002 from Stewart Connectors in Glen Rock where she was employed as a Machine Operator and Inspector for 13 years. She was a former member of Bethlehem Steltz Reformed Church and enjoyed gardening, flowers, raspberries, reading, sitting in the sun and spending time with her family She leaves five children, William U. Black, Jr. and his wife Christy of Mapleton, PA; Sylvia J. Bisker of New Park; Joseph M. Black; Rhoda M. Sheeler and her husband Andy; and Yvonna L. Chenowith and her husband Charles; all of New Freedom; 11 grandchildren, Olivia, Will, Sammy, Gary, Leslie, Jaramie, Carl, Jonathan, Jacqueline, David and Zachary; 11 great grandchildren, Danny, Richard, Peiton, Jasper, Kylian, Jeremy, Lily, Lexi, Ari, Bently, Mika and one on the way; a brother, Ralph Singer, Jr. of Stewartstown. She also was predeceased by two sisters, Shirley S. Wood and Doris Hunter.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to American Cancer Society, 314 Good Dr, Lancaster, PA 17603 or to the American Diabetes Association, 150 Monument Road, Suite 100, Bala Cynwyd, Pennsylvania, 19004. A very special thank you to her nurses, Roni King, Stella Johnson, Jovonna Holmes and Amy Belle for their excellent care and also to the staff of Hospice and Community Care.
